Three less than the product of 4 and the number is equal to 5

    4n-3=5

    Step-by-step explanation:

    If you read it step by step the product of and a number is basically 4 * any variable. (In this case I use n.) Next the beginning part is 3 less than the product part so it is 4n-3. And finally the whole equation is equal to 5 so itis 4n-3=5.
